|| 𝙱𝚊𝚌𝚔𝚜𝚝𝚘𝚛𝚢 ||

Satoru Gojo was born the strongest, cursed with power vast enough to bend the world and isolate him from it. The Six Eyes and Limitless made him untouchable, but also untethered. From childhood, strength replaced closeness, expectation replaced choice.

Suguru Geto was the one person who stood beside him, equal enough to matter. Together, they believed strength existed to protect. That belief fractured when the system proved sorcerers were disposable, and Geto walked away from humanity entirely.

After killing Suguru with his own hands, Satoru chose a different rebellion. He stayed. He became a teacher, a shield, a weapon aimed at the future. The strongest, standing alone, carrying the quiet certainty that if he failed again, the world would end.
